Coppermineは、PHPで記述された、多目的で完全な機能を備えた統合されたウェブ画像ギャラリースクリプトであり、ユーザーが画像や写真を整理できるようにします。コッパーマインフォトギャラリーは、最も古く、最も人気のあるWeb画像ギャラリースクリプトの1つです。
Coppermineには、ユーザー管理(グループ、プライベートギャラリーなど)、eカード機能、自動サムネイル作成、ユーザーコメント、スライドショービューアなどの機能があります。
このチュートリアルでは、 Ubuntu14.04VPSにCopperminePhotoGalleryをインストールする方法について説明します。 。このチュートリアルは、他のDebianベースのLinuxディストリビューションでも機能するはずです。
このインストールガイドは、Apache、MySQL、およびPHPが仮想サーバーにすでにインストールおよび構成されていることを前提としています。このチュートリアルを書いている時点で、Coppermine Photo Galleryの最新の安定バージョンは1.5.38であり、次のものが必要です。
- ApacheWebサーバー。
- GDグラフィックライブラリが有効になっているPHP(バージョン4.3.0以降)またはImageMagick。
- LinuxVPSにインストールされたMySQL。
インストール手順:
SSH経由でサーバーにログインします:
ssh root@server_ip
システムを更新し、必要なパッケージをインストールします:
apt-get update && sudo apt-get -y upgrade apt-get install unzip
コッパーマインフォトギャラリーアーカイブをダウンロードして抽出します:
wget http://downloads.sourceforge.net/project/coppermine/Coppermine/1.5.x/cpg1.5.38.zip unzip cpg1.5.38.zip mv cpg15x/ /var/www/html/coppermine
Coppermine Photo Galleryには、「/ var / www / html/coppermine」ディレクトリ内の「albums」および「include」ディレクトリへの書き込みアクセス権が必要です。これは、次のコマンドを実行することで簡単に実行できます。
chown www-data:www-data -R /var/www/html/coppermine
PHP構成ファイルを見つけます:
# php -i | grep -i php.ini Configuration File (php.ini) Path => /etc/php5/cli Loaded Configuration File => /etc/php5/cli/php.ini
「/etc/php5/apache2/php.ini」構成ファイルを編集します:
nano /etc/php5/cli/php.ini
次の設定を追加/変更します:
max_execution_time = 300 max_input_time = 300 memory_limit = 256M post_max_size = 32M upload_max_filesize = 32M
サーバー上にCopperminePhotoGallery用の新しいMySQLデータベースを作成します:
mysql -u root -p mysql> CREATE DATABASE copperminedb; mysql> GRANT ALL PRIVILEGES ON copperminedb.* TO 'coppermineuser'@'localhost' IDENTIFIED BY 'your-password' WITH GRANT OPTION; mysql> FLUSH PRIVILEGES; mysql> quit
「your-password」を強力なパスワードに置き換えることを忘れないでください。
Apacheで新しい仮想ホストディレクティブを作成します。たとえば、仮想サーバー上に「coppermine.conf」という名前の新しいApache構成ファイルを作成します。
touch /etc/apache2/sites-available/coppermine.conf ln -s /etc/apache2/sites-available/coppermine.conf /etc/apache2/sites-enabled/coppermine.conf nano /etc/apache2/sites-available/coppermine.conf
次に、次の行を追加します。
<VirtualHost *:80> ServerAdmin [email protected] DocumentRoot /var/www/html/coppermine/ ServerName your-domain.com ServerAlias www.your-domain.com <Directory /var/www/html/coppermine/> Options FollowSymLinks AllowOverride All </Directory> ErrorLog /var/log/apache2/your-domain.com-error_log CustomLog /var/log/apache2/your-domain.com-access_log common </VirtualHost>
変更を有効にするには、ApacheWebサーバーを再起動します。
service apache2 restart
お気に入りのWebブラウザーを開き、http://your-domain.com/install.phpに移動し、インストール画面の簡単な指示に従って、必要な情報を要求に応じて挿入します。 「GD2」(または、サーバーにImageMagickパッケージがインストールされている場合は「ImageMagick」)を選択し、MySQLのユーザー名とパスワードを入力して、最後にCoppermine管理アカウントを作成します。
それだ。 Ubuntu14.04VPSにCopperminePhotoGalleryが正常にインストールされました。管理者のバックエンドにログインして、写真のアップロードを開始し、フォトアルバムを公開します。
もちろん、Ubuntu Linux VPSホスティングサービスのいずれかを使用している場合は、これを行う必要はありません。その場合は、専門のLinux管理者に CopperminePhotoGalleryのインストールを依頼するだけです。 あなたのために。 24時間年中無休でご利用いただけます。リクエストはすぐに処理されます。
PS。 この投稿が気に入った場合は、左側のボタンを使用してソーシャルネットワーク上の友達と共有するか、下に返信を残してください。ありがとう。